Using BEVERAGE
BEVERAGE lets you heat a beverage by
touching just one pad.
NOTES:
. Before using BEVERAGE, be sure the
time of day is showing on the Display. lf
the time of day is not on the Display, touch
OFF/CANCEL once or twice to clear.
l
If you want to change the heating time
after choosing BEVERAGE, see “Adding or
subtracting cook time” on page 35.
1. Place
cup
of beverage In oven and close door.
2. Choose BEVERAGE.
